3 Typical Root Causes Of Water Spots on Walls


As opposed to popular belief, water spots on walls do not always stem from inadequate structure products. There are a number of reasons for water stains on wall surfaces. These consist of:

Poor Drainage


When making a structure strategy, it is essential to ensure appropriate drain. This will stop water from seeping right into the wall surfaces. Where the drainage system is clogged or nonexistent, below ground wetness develops. This links to excessive moisture that you observe on the walls of your building.
So, the leading reason for damp wall surfaces, in this situation, can be a poor water drainage system. It can additionally be because of poor management of sewer pipes that go through the building.

Wet


When hot wet air consults with dry cool air, it triggers water droplets to base on the walls of structures. When there is steam from food preparation or showers, this occurs in cooking areas and washrooms. The water beads can stain the bordering walls in these parts of your home and also spread to various other locations.
Moist or condensation influences the roof and walls of structures. This creates them to appear darker than various other locations of the house. When the wall surface is wet, it produces an ideal atmosphere for the development of fungi as well as microbes. These may have negative results on health, such as allergies as well as respiratory disorders.

Pipe Leaks


A lot of homes have a network of water pipes within the walls. It always increases the viability of such pipes, as there is little oxygen within the walls.
A disadvantage to this is that water leak impacts the walls of the building and also creates prevalent damages. A dead giveaway of malfunctioning pipes is the appearance of a water stain on the wall surface.

    How to Remove Water Stains From Your Walls Without Repainting


    The easy way to get water stains off walls


    Water stains aren t going to appear on tile; they need a more absorbent surface, which is why they show up on bare walls. Since your walls are probably painted, this presents a problem: How can you wash a wall without damaging it and risk needing to repait the entire room?


    According to Igloo Surfaces, you should start gently and only increase the intensity of your cleaning methods if basic remedies don t get the job done. Start with a simple solution of dish soap and warm water, at a ratio of about one to two. Use a cloth dipped in the mixture to apply the soapy water to your stain. Gently rub it in from the top down, then rinse with plain water and dry thoroughly with a hair dryer on a cool setting.



    If that doesn t work, fill a spray bottle with a mixture of vinegar, lemon juice, and baking soda. Shake it up and spray it on the stain. Leave it for about an hour, then use a damp cloth to rub it away. You may have to repeat this process a few times to get the stain all the way out, so do this when you have time for multiple hour-long soaking intervals.


    How to get water stains out of wood


    Maybe you have wood paneling or cabinets that are looking grody from water stains too, whether in your kitchen or bathroom. Per Better Homes and Gardens, you have a few options for removing water marks on your wooden surfaces.


  • You can let mayonnaise sit on your stain overnight, then wipe it away in the morning and polish your wood afterward.


  • You can also mix equal parts vinegar and olive oil and apply to the stain with a cloth, wiping in the direction of the grain until the stain disappears. Afterward, wipe the surface down with a clean, dry cloth.


  • Try placing an iron on a low heat setting over a cloth on top of the stain. Press it down for a few seconds and remove it to see if the stain is letting up, then try again until you re satisfied. (Be advised that this works best for still-damp stains.)
